The Inflation of Illusions: How Metrics Became Marketing
Let’s start with the usual suspects. Take unemployment, for example. The government often touts the U3 rate, the clean, PR-friendly version. But that figure conveniently ignores the long-term unemployed, people who’ve given up looking, and those stuck in part-time jobs they'd rather escape. The more comprehensive U6 rate paints a darker picture, but even that underestimates the true pain in the labor market.
Then there’s the Consumer Price Index (CPI), a number so tortured it should be illegal. When it started, the CPI was based on a fixed basket of household essentials, real goods used in everyday life that didn’t change over time. But as the cost of living rose, they started tweaking that basket to suit their narrative. Through hedonic adjustments, substitution bias, and conveniently excluding volatile essentials like food and energy, they now sculpt a fantasy where inflation is “manageable.” Try telling that to anyone filling up their tank or buying groceries.
GDP isn’t innocent either. It counts government spending, regardless of efficiency or necessity, as economic growth. Borrow a trillion to dig holes and fill them again? GDP goes up. That’s not progress. That’s a pyrotechnic show of smoke and mirrors.
Anywhere the dollar is used as a metric, manipulation is baked in. It's not just inflation, it's distortion at every level. Money has become a tool not for measuring value, but for masking decline. The Origins of the 2% Inflation Target
The idea that 2% inflation is good for you didn’t descend from the heavens. It wasn’t proven in a lab, discovered in some ancient scroll, or derived from mathematical certainties. It was, quite frankly, made up.
The story goes back to New Zealand in the late 1980s. Their central bank decided, almost arbitrarily, to adopt a 2% inflation target as a benchmark to tame wild price fluctuations. The idea stuck. Other central banks, including the Federal Reserve, picked it up like a catchy jingle. Before long, it was economic orthodoxy.
But here’s the thing: this “target” doesn’t have your back. It’s not designed to help the average worker, saver, or retiree. It’s designed to benefit debtors. And who’s the biggest debtor on the planet? Governments. When your currency loses value, so does the real burden of the debt they owe. Meanwhile, your dollars—your hard-earned savings—are quietly burning.
The Math Behind the Scam
Let’s do some simple math, shall we? At 2% annual inflation, your purchasing power is cut in half roughly every 35 years. That’s not a policy. It's a pickpocket in a three-piece suit.
Imagine you saved $10,000 and stuck it under your mattress. Thirty-five years later, it buys half as much. You didn’t spend a dime, but your money still disappeared. That’s what central banks call “price stability.”
And it gets worse. The compounding effect of inflation means prices don’t just rise. They accelerate. Milk, gas, rent, healthcare, education. Name the item, and it’s gone parabolic in price. Meanwhile, wages have lagged behind for decades. Sure, your paycheck might go up, but if bread, rent, and electricity go up faster, are you really ahead?
This is not progress. This is a treadmill designed to make you feel like you’re moving forward when you’re actually standing still.

Think of this like building a castle. You start with the foundation: understanding self-custody. Then you add the walls: hardware wallets. And finally, the moat: multisig. Each layer is a choice to protect what’s yours.
A self-custodied Bitcoin wallet is the modern vault. But instead of being buried underground with a steel door, it lives in your pocket, encrypted, secure, and immune to the whims of governments or banks. When you use a hardware wallet like a Trezor, Ledger, or Coldcard, you're putting a digital padlock on your wealth that only you control. Your keys never touch the internet. Your Bitcoin never leaves your command.
When FTX collapsed, thousands learned the hard way. Trusting an exchange is like giving your house keys to a stranger and hoping they don’t throw a party while you're gone. The bitter truth? If you don’t hold it, you don’t own it.
For those looking to go deeper, multisig setups offer an even higher level of protection. By requiring multiple keys to move funds, you're spreading risk across people, locations, or devices. Think of it like splitting the combination to your safe among trusted allies. It's perfect for inheritance planning, business holdings, or just sleeping better at night.
